返回

анимация работает медленно?

前端

В мире, одержимом погоней за эффектами, где каждая секунда на счету, мало что так раздражает, как медленная, отстающая анимация. Будь то из-за потери пакетов, низкой производительности или просто устаревшего кода, заикающаяся анимация может превратить пользовательский интерфейс из гладкого и привлекательного в неприятный и разочаровывающий.

Для тех из вас, кто сталкивается с этой проблемой, не паникуйте! Мы здесь, чтобы помочь. Вот несколько советов, как ускорить анимацию и снова сделать ваш пользовательский интерфейс привлекательным:

  • Оптимизируйте изображения: Большие или не оптимизированные изображения могут значительно замедлить анимацию. Используйте инструменты сжатия, такие как TinyPNG или JPEGmini, чтобы уменьшить размер изображений без ущерба для качества.

  • Используйте спрайты: Спрайты - это отдельные изображения, которые объединяются в один файл. Вместо того, чтобы загружать несколько изображений по отдельности, загрузка одного файла спрайта может значительно ускорить анимацию.

  • Используйте кэширование: Кэширование позволяет повторно использовать недавно загруженные данные, что уменьшает время загрузки. Включите кэширование в своем приложении, чтобы ускорить повторную загрузку изображений и других ресурсов.

  • Минимизируйте код: Избыточный код может замедлить анимацию. Удалите любые ненужные пробелы, комментарии или неиспользуемые переменные, чтобы уменьшить размер файла кода.

  • Используйте аппаратное ускорение: Многие современные устройства поддерживают аппаратное ускорение для графики. Включите аппаратное ускорение в своем приложении, чтобы использовать возможности графического процессора устройства.

  • Проверьте свои сети: Медленная сеть может привести к задержкам в загрузке ресурсов, что замедляет анимацию. Проверьте скорость своего интернет-соединения и убедитесь, что оно стабильно.

  • Используйте CDN: Сеть доставки контента (CDN) распределяет контент по нескольким серверам, расположенным по всему миру. Это может сократить расстояние, которое данные должны преодолеть, чтобы добраться до пользователей, что приводит к более быстрой загрузке и более плавной анимации.

Если вы уже попробовали эти советы, но анимация по-прежнему медленная, возможно, проблема в другом. Копайте глубже, чтобы выявить основную причину, и соответствующим образом скорректируйте свою стратегию оптимизации.

Помните, что анимация - это важный аспект пользовательского опыта. Плавно работающая анимация делает ваш пользовательский интерфейс более отзывчивым и привлекательным. Следуя этим советам, вы можете оптимизировать свою анимацию и создать бесперебойный пользовательский интерфейс, который понравится вашим пользователям.